+#pragma once
+
+#ifdef CONFIG_PGTRACE
+#include <stdbool.h>
+#include <mach/vm_types.h>
+#include <mach/mach_types.h>
+
+#define RR_NUM_MAX              2
+#define PGTRACE_STACK_DEPTH     8
+
+typedef enum {
+    PGTRACE_RW_LOAD,
+    PGTRACE_RW_STORE,
+    PGTRACE_RW_PREFETCH
+} pgtrace_rw_t;
+
+typedef struct {
+    vm_offset_t ad_addr;
+    uint64_t    ad_data;
+} pgtrace_addr_data_t;
+
+typedef struct {
+    uint64_t            rr_time;
+    pgtrace_rw_t        rr_rw;
+    uint8_t             rr_num;
+    pgtrace_addr_data_t rr_addrdata[RR_NUM_MAX];
+} pgtrace_run_result_t;
+
+#ifdef CONFIG_PGTRACE_NONKEXT
+#ifdef XNU_KERNEL_PRIVATE
+#define PGTRACE_OPTION_KPRINTF  0x1
+#define PGTRACE_OPTION_STACK    0x2
+#define PGTRACE_OPTION_SPIN     0x4
+
+typedef struct {
+    struct {
+        uint32_t sl_bytes;
+    } stat_logger;
+
+    struct {
+        uint64_t sd_ldr;
+        uint64_t sd_str;
+        uint64_t sd_ldrs;
+        uint64_t sd_ldtr;
+        uint64_t sd_sttr;
+        uint64_t sd_ldtrs;
+        uint64_t sd_ldp;
+        uint64_t sd_stp;
+        uint64_t sd_ldpsw;
+        uint64_t sd_prfm;
+
+        uint64_t sd_c335;
+        uint64_t sd_c336;
+        uint64_t sd_c337;
+        uint64_t sd_c338;
+        uint64_t sd_c339;
+        uint64_t sd_c3310;
+        uint64_t sd_c3311;
+        uint64_t sd_c3312;
+        uint64_t sd_c3313;
+        uint64_t sd_c3314;
+        uint64_t sd_c3315;
+        uint64_t sd_c3316;
+    } stat_decoder;
+} pgtrace_stats_t;
+
+void pgtrace_init(void);
+int pgtrace_add_probe(thread_t thread, vm_offset_t start, vm_offset_t end);
+void pgtrace_clear_probe(void);
+void pgtrace_start(void);
+void pgtrace_stop(void);
+uint32_t pgtrace_get_size(void);
+bool pgtrace_set_size(uint32_t);
+void pgtrace_clear_trace(void);
+boolean_t pgtrace_active(void);
+uint32_t pgtrace_get_option(void);
+void pgtrace_set_option(uint32_t option);
+int64_t pgtrace_read_log(uint8_t *buf, uint32_t size);
+void pgtrace_write_log(pgtrace_run_result_t res);
+int pgtrace_get_stats(pgtrace_stats_t *stats);
+#endif
+#else // CONFIG_PGTRACE_NONKEXT
+#ifdef __cplusplus
+extern "C" {
+#endif
+typedef struct {
+    vm_offset_t addr;
+    uint64_t    bytes;
+} pgtrace_instruction_info_t;
+
+typedef struct { 
+    uint64_t                id;
+    pgtrace_run_result_t    res;
+    void                    *stack[PGTRACE_STACK_DEPTH];
+} log_t;
+
+typedef int (*run_func_t)(uint32_t inst, vm_offset_t pa, vm_offset_t va, void *ss, pgtrace_run_result_t *res);
+typedef bool (*decode_func_t)(uint32_t inst, void *ss, pgtrace_instruction_info_t *info);
+typedef void (*write_func_t)(pgtrace_run_result_t res);
+
+typedef struct {
+    uint64_t            magic;
+    char                *arch;
+    char                *desc; 
+    decode_func_t       decode;
+    run_func_t          run;
+} decoder_t;
+
+typedef struct {
+    uint64_t        magic;
+    char            *arch;
+    char            *desc; 
+    write_func_t    write;
+} logger_t;
+
+//------------------------------------
+// for pmap fault handler
+//------------------------------------
+int pgtrace_decode_and_run(uint32_t inst, vm_offset_t fva, vm_map_offset_t *cva_page, arm_saved_state_t *ss, pgtrace_run_result_t *res);
+int pgtrace_write_log(pgtrace_run_result_t res);
+
+//------------------------------------
+// for kext
+//------------------------------------
+int pgtrace_init(decoder_t *decoder, logger_t *logger);
+int pgtrace_add_probe(thread_t thread, vm_offset_t start, vm_offset_t end);
+void pgtrace_clear_probe(void);
+void pgtrace_start(void);
+void pgtrace_stop(void);
+bool pgtrace_active(void);
+#ifdef __cplusplus
+}
+#endif
+#endif // CONFIG_PGTRACE_NONKEXT
+#endif
